Tyrrell Hatton has heaped praise on the crowds at LIV Golf UK after carding a five-under 66 on day one at JCB.

Hatton’s day didn’t start well after he made a double bogey on his first hole. However, the 32-year-old battled back and made seven birdies to finish three shots back of leader Jon Rahm.

Hatton is testing a new putter this week and appears to have quickly found a groove with his flat stick.

Tyrrell Hatton loves ‘big tournament’ feel at LIV Golf UK

The JCB event has proven popular, with English fans snapping up all available ground pass tickets.

It appears the atmosphere on the course is also positive, and Hatton has claimed many of the players would’ve enjoyed their rounds as a result.

“Playing in front of English fans, they were quite vocal out there today, which was nice,” Hatton said. “It really felt like you’re playing a big tournament, which is great. I think all the players would have enjoyed that today.”

Tyrrell Hatton continues remarkable LIV Golf form

Unfortunately, Hatton didn’t contend at last week’s Open Championship. But his LIV Golf form shows no sign of letting up.

After landing his first win in Nashville, the Englishman went on to place third in Andalucia.

LIV Golf leader Joaquin Niemann is in a commanding position at the top of the standings, but a win for Hatton this week will propel him above Sergio Garcia and teammate Rahm.

Much like we saw in Nashville, Rahm and Hatton could be set to go head-to-head once more this weekend.
